IC Phoenix logo

Home ›  M  › M6 > M29W040B90N6

M29W040B90N6 from ST,ST Microelectronics

Fast Delivery, Competitive Price @IC-phoenix

If you need more electronic components or better pricing, we welcome any inquiry.

M29W040B90N6

Manufacturer: ST

4 MBIT (512KB X8, UNIFORM BLOCK) LOW VOLTAGE SINGLE SUPPLY FLASH MEMORY

Partnumber Manufacturer Quantity Availability
M29W040B90N6 ST 1706 In Stock

Description and Introduction

4 MBIT (512KB X8, UNIFORM BLOCK) LOW VOLTAGE SINGLE SUPPLY FLASH MEMORY The **M29W040B90N6** is a Flash memory device manufactured by **STMicroelectronics (ST)**. Below are its key specifications, descriptions, and features based on available factual data:

### **Manufacturer:**  
- **STMicroelectronics (ST)**  

### **Specifications:**  
- **Memory Type:** Flash  
- **Density:** 4 Mbit (512K x 8)  
- **Technology:** NOR Flash  
- **Supply Voltage:**  
  - **VCC (Core):** 2.7V to 3.6V  
  - **VPP (Programming Voltage):** 12V (optional for fast programming)  
- **Access Time:** 90 ns  
- **Operating Temperature Range:**  
  - **Commercial:** 0°C to +70°C  
  - **Industrial:** -40°C to +85°C  
- **Package:**  
  - **PLCC32 (Plastic Leaded Chip Carrier, 32-pin)**  
  - **TSOP32 (Thin Small Outline Package, 32-pin)**  

### **Descriptions:**  
- The **M29W040B90N6** is a **4 Mbit (512K x 8) NOR Flash memory** with a **uniform 64 KB sector architecture**.  
- It supports **asynchronous read operations** with a **90 ns access time**.  
- The device is **byte-programmable** and supports **sector erase (64 KB sectors)** or **chip erase** functionality.  
- It features a **hardware and software data protection** mechanism to prevent accidental writes.  

### **Features:**  
- **High Performance:**  
  - **90 ns access time** for fast read operations.  
- **Low Power Consumption:**  
  - **Standby current:** 1 µA (typical).  
  - **Active read current:** 15 mA (typical).  
- **Flexible Erase & Programming:**  
  - **Byte programming time:** 20 µs (typical).  
  - **Sector erase time:** 1 s (typical).  
  - **Chip erase time:** 15 s (typical).  
- **Reliability:**  
  - **Endurance:** 100,000 write/erase cycles per sector.  
  - **Data retention:** 20 years.  
- **Compatibility:**  
  - **JEDEC-standard pinout** for easy replacement.  
  - **Single power supply operation** (2.7V to 3.6V).  
- **Protection Features:**  
  - **Hardware write protection** via WP# pin.  
  - **Software data protection (SDP)** to prevent accidental writes.  

### **Applications:**  
- Embedded systems  
- Firmware storage  
- Automotive electronics  
- Industrial control systems  
- Networking equipment  

This information is based on the official **STMicroelectronics datasheet** for the **M29W040B90N6**. For precise details, always refer to the latest manufacturer documentation.

Application Scenarios & Design Considerations

4 MBIT (512KB X8, UNIFORM BLOCK) LOW VOLTAGE SINGLE SUPPLY FLASH MEMORY# Technical Documentation: M29W040B90N6 4-Mbit (512Kb x8) Boot Block Flash Memory

## 1. Application Scenarios

### 1.1 Typical Use Cases
The M29W040B90N6 is a 4-Mbit (512Kb x8) NOR Flash memory device organized as 8 sectors with asymmetrical boot block architecture. Its primary use cases include:

*  Firmware Storage : Ideal for storing boot code, application firmware, and configuration data in embedded systems. The asymmetrical boot block structure (one 16 Kbyte, two 8 Kbyte, and one 96 Kbyte parameter blocks, plus a main 384 Kbyte block) provides flexibility for different bootloader and application partitioning strategies.

*  Code Shadowing : Frequently employed in systems where code executes directly from flash (execute-in-place, XiP), particularly in microcontroller-based designs without external RAM. The fast access times (90ns maximum) enable efficient code execution.

*  Data Logging : Suitable for non-volatile storage of operational parameters, event logs, and calibration data in industrial equipment, though endurance limitations (minimum 100,000 erase/program cycles per sector) require careful wear-leveling implementation for frequent writes.

*  Configuration Storage : Used to store device settings, network parameters, and user preferences in consumer electronics, networking equipment, and telecommunications devices.

### 1.2 Industry Applications

*  Automotive Electronics : Engine control units (ECUs), instrument clusters, and infotainment systems (for boot code and calibration data storage). The extended temperature range (-40°C to +85°C) supports automotive environmental requirements.

*  Industrial Control Systems : Programmable logic controllers (PLCs), human-machine interfaces (HMIs), and sensor nodes where reliable non-volatile storage is required for control algorithms and operational parameters.

*  Consumer Electronics : Set-top boxes, routers, printers, and gaming peripherals for firmware and configuration storage.

*  Medical Devices : Patient monitoring equipment and diagnostic tools requiring reliable code storage with data retention of 20 years minimum.

*  Telecommunications : Network switches, routers, and base station controllers for boot code and operational firmware.

### 1.3 Practical Advantages and Limitations

 Advantages: 
*  Boot Block Architecture : The asymmetrical sector arrangement provides dedicated, protected areas for boot code while maximizing usable space for application code.
*  Low Power Consumption : Typical active current of 15mA (read) and 30mA (program/erase) with deep power-down mode (1µA typical) extends battery life in portable applications.
*  Single Voltage Operation : 2.7V to 3.6V supply range enables direct connection to 3.3V systems without level shifting.
*  Hardware Data Protection : WP# (Write Protect) pin and programmable block protection bits prevent accidental modification of critical code sections.
*  Standard Interface : JEDEC-compliant command set ensures compatibility with industry-standard flash controllers and software drivers.

 Limitations: 
*  Limited Endurance : 100,000 program/erase cycles per sector restricts frequent write operations, necessitating wear-leveling algorithms for data storage applications.
*  Page Programming Limitation : Maximum 256 bytes per programming operation requires multiple commands for larger data blocks.
*  Sector Erase Only : Cannot erase individual bytes or words; entire sectors (minimum 8KB) must be erased, increasing overhead for small modifications.
*  Speed Considerations : While suitable for XiP applications, 90ns access time may be insufficient for high-performance processors without wait states or caching.
*  Legacy Technology : Being a parallel NOR flash, it requires more pins (29 address lines, 8 data lines, plus control signals) compared to serial flash alternatives, increasing PCB complexity.

## 2. Design Considerations

### 2.1 Common Design Pitfalls and

Request Quotation

For immediate assistance, call us at +86 533 2716050 or email [email protected]

Part Number Quantity Target Price($USD) Email Contact Person
We offer highly competitive channel pricing. Get in touch for details.

Specializes in hard-to-find components chips